If you’ve been searching for a chicken dish that perfectly blends crunch and sweetness, this Crispy Honey Garlic Chicken is the answer. With its golden, crispy coating and sticky honey-garlic glaze, this recipe delivers irresistible flavor in every bite — and it’s surprisingly simple to make!
| For the Crispy Chicken | For the Honey Garlic Sauce | 
|---|---|
| 2 large boneless, skinless chicken breasts (cut in half lengthwise and pounded) | 1/2 cup honey | 
| 2 large eggs, beaten + 1 tbsp water | 2 tsp minced garlic | 
| 1 cup all-purpose flour | 2 tbsp soy sauce | 
| 1 tsp cayenne pepper | 1 tbsp cornstarch + 3 tbsp cold water | 
| 1 tsp smoked paprika | |
| 1/2 tsp salt | |
| 1/4 tsp black pepper | |
| 1/2 tsp garlic powder | |
| 1/4 cup vegetable oil | 
Step 1: Make the Honey Garlic Sauce
Place a small saucepan over medium heat and add the soy sauce, honey, and minced garlic. Stir to combine. Bring the mixture to a gentle boil, then reduce the heat to medium-low.
Step 2: Thicken the Sauce
In a separate bowl, mix the cornstarch with the cold water until smooth. Gradually pour this mixture into the saucepan, stirring continuously. Cook until the sauce thickens, then remove it from the heat and set aside.
Step 3: Prepare the Chicken Coating
In a shallow dish, combine the flour, cayenne pepper, smoked paprika, salt, black pepper, and garlic powder. Mix well to distribute the seasonings evenly.
In another bowl, whisk together the beaten eggs and water.
Step 4: Dredge the Chicken
Dip each piece of chicken first into the egg mixture, ensuring it’s fully coated, then dredge it in the seasoned flour mixture. Shake off any excess flour.
Step 5: Fry the Chicken
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the coated chicken pieces carefully to the pan and cook for about 4–5 minutes per side, or until golden brown, crispy, and cooked through.
Step 6: Combine Chicken and Sauce
Once the chicken is done, transfer it to a large bowl. Pour the prepared honey garlic sauce over the chicken and gently toss to coat every piece evenly.
Step 7: Garnish and Serve
Sprinkle with sesame seeds and chopped green onions for an optional finishing touch. Serve the Crispy Honey Garlic Chicken hot, alongside steamed rice or your favorite side dishes.
